OSAKA NOH FESTA

The Kanze School of Noh was developed by Kan'ami and Zeami, famous performers who completed the current form of Noh, in the Muromachi period (1300s A.D.) and has been passed down through the generations for approximately 700 years. Led by the 26th head of the Soke Kiyokazu Kanze, the noh theaters in Osaka will join to introduce the art of noh to visitors from Japan and overseas in preparation for the Expo 2025, Osaka, Kansai. With the “Noh Boat Performance” as a symbol of Aqua Metropolis Osaka, we provide opportunities for visitors to experience noh performances in various forms.

Noh Performance on the Ship

Tenjinmatsuri Festival’s noh boat will be specially docked at the pier for 3 days for Noh Festa, where noh and kyogen will be performed on the boat's stage, and workshops will be held to for visitors to understand noh even further. This is the first time for noh boat to be used outside of the Tenjinmatsuri Festival, and the performances will be held in concurrently with “Autumn Aqua Metropolis Osaka Week,” an annual waterfront event held in Osaka City.

Noh Festa in Uemachi

A full-scale noh performance held on the noh stage at Ohtsuki Noh Theatre, a Registered Tangible Cultural Property (structure). Japanese and English audio guides are available for all seats.

Noh Festa in Tanimachi

In the luxurious Yamamoto Noh Threatre, a National Registered Tangible Cultural Property, noh performance will be held with a Japanese-English bilingual host, commentaries, and subtitles. In addition, for the audiences to have a deeper understanding of noh, phone apps and 3D Noh masks will be used to introduce noh from multiple perspectives. Tea ceremony experience will also be held in the tearoom on the second floor, a great opportunity for the guests to experience the spirit of hospitality unique to Japan.

Noh Festa in Temma Tenjin

A rare opportunity to experience noh, kyogen, and hayashi (hands-on experiences involving the noh flute, small hand drum, large hand drum, and stick drum) under the guidance of professionals. English interpreter will be available. During lunch time, the guests will have the chance to listen to koto performance while enjoying matcha green tea and Shokado bento box lunch, among other Japanese cultural experiences.
